Some tips for your application 🫡
Understand the Role: Read the job description thoroughly to grasp the key responsibilities and skills required for the Business Development Account Manager position. Tailor your application to highlight how your experience aligns with these requirements.
Craft a Compelling CV: Ensure your CV is up-to-date and clearly outlines your relevant experience in business development and account management. Use quantifiable achievements to demonstrate your impact in previous roles.
Write a Tailored Cover Letter: Your cover letter should reflect your enthusiasm for the role and the company. Mention specific projects or initiatives that resonate with you and explain how you can contribute to their goals.
Proofread Your Application: Before submitting, carefully proofread your CV and cover letter for any spelling or grammatical errors. A polished application reflects your attention to detail and professionalism.
